London: John Long Limited, 1974. Clean black cloth on boards with gilt titles. Edges: foxing. Bookseller sticker to ffep foot. Clean contents. Binding is As New. 181p Dj: moderate soiling, rubbings and scratches. Mildly old shelf-sunned. Spine; head & foot with paperthin wear and short split to side edge. Head & foot of flaps spine with small wear and chips. . First Edition. Hb. VG/VG.
